The LG V60 ThinQ 5G is a solid choice for users looking for a large, sharp OLED display with its 6.8-inch screen and 2460 x 1080 resolution, offering vibrant colors and good pixel density. Its camera system is quite versatile with a high-resolution 64 MP main rear camera and additional sensors, plus a 10 MP front camera, making it a good option for photography enthusiasts. Battery life is impressive, featuring a large 5000 mAh battery that can provide up to 20 hours of talk time, so you can expect a full day of regular use without frequent charging.

Performance-wise, the Snapdragon processor paired with 8 GB of RAM delivers smooth operation for gaming, streaming, and multitasking. Storage is adequate at 128 GB, which might feel limiting if you save lots of media or apps. The phone runs on Android, providing access to a wide range of apps and updates, but this specific model is locked to T-Mobile. Build quality is sturdy with water resistance, though it lacks a headphone jack which could be inconvenient if you use wired headphones. The fingerprint sensor adds a nice security touch.

This device is well-suited for users who want a large screen, long battery life, and strong cameras, especially if they are on T-Mobile and don’t mind missing a headphone jack.

The LG V50 ThinQ 5G is a strong option for those seeking a 5G phone with a vibrant and sharp display. Its 6.4-inch OLED screen provides high resolution and bright colors, making it ideal for watching videos or browsing photos. The phone’s versatile camera setup includes three rear cameras and two front cameras, catering to a variety of photography and selfie needs.

Powered by a Snapdragon 855 processor and 6GB of RAM, the device handles apps and games smoothly. It offers 128GB of built-in storage and supports microSD cards up to 2TB, providing ample space for apps, pictures, and videos. The 4000 mAh battery supports typical daily use, though heavy talkers may need to charge more frequently. Running on Android 9.0, some newer software features found in more recent phones are not included.

The phone features water resistance and fingerprint recognition for security but lacks a headphone jack, which might be inconvenient for users of wired headphones. Additionally, this model is locked to Verizon, making it suitable primarily for Verizon customers. Its solid build and sleek design reflect its 2018 release, which may feel somewhat bulkier compared to newer models. Overall, the LG V50 ThinQ delivers good performance, a great display, and versatile cameras for multimedia and photography enthusiasts, with considerations for software version and carrier lock.

The LG Velvet (5G) offers a large 6.8-inch OLED display with a sharp 2460 x 1080 resolution, making it great for watching videos and browsing with vibrant colors and decent sharpness. Its triple rear camera setup includes a 48MP main sensor, which captures detailed photos and supports modes like night and portrait, although it records video at 1080p rather than 4K, which may feel limiting for some users.

The 4300 mAh battery should comfortably last through a day of typical use, supported by a reasonably efficient processor running at 2.4 GHz and 6 GB of RAM, ensuring smooth everyday performance and multitasking. Storage comes with 128 GB internal memory, which is ample for apps, photos, and media. The phone runs on Android 10, which is functional but behind the latest Android versions, and this model is T-Mobile/Sprint unlocked with no support for AT&T’s 5G network or CDMA carriers like Cricket, which could limit its compatibility with some users.

Build quality is solid with a water-resistant design, fingerprint security, and a headphone jack (adapter needed), though this particular unit is certified refurbished, meaning it may have minor cosmetic wear and comes with only generic charging accessories in a non-retail box. If you’re looking for a stylish, media-friendly smartphone with decent cameras and battery life on T-Mobile’s network, the LG Velvet is a good option, but those needing the latest Android features or broader carrier support might find it less suitable.

Buying Guide for the Best LG Smartphones

Choosing the right LG smartphone involves understanding your needs and preferences. LG offers a variety of smartphones with different features, so it's important to know what specifications matter most to you. Whether you prioritize camera quality, battery life, or performance, knowing what to look for can help you make an informed decision.
DisplayThe display is the screen of the smartphone, and it's important because it's what you'll be looking at and interacting with most of the time. LG smartphones come with different types of displays, such as LCD and OLED. OLED displays generally offer better color accuracy and deeper blacks, making them ideal for media consumption. Screen size also matters; larger screens are great for watching videos and gaming, while smaller screens are more portable and easier to handle. Choose a display type and size based on your usage habits.
CameraThe camera is crucial for those who love taking photos and videos. LG smartphones often feature multiple cameras with varying megapixel counts and functionalities like wide-angle lenses and night mode. Higher megapixels generally mean better image quality, but other factors like aperture size and software optimization also play a role. If photography is important to you, look for models with advanced camera features and higher megapixel counts. If you only take occasional photos, a basic camera setup will suffice.
Battery LifeBattery life determines how long your smartphone can last on a single charge. LG smartphones come with different battery capacities measured in milliampere-hours (mAh). Higher mAh values usually mean longer battery life, but usage patterns also affect this. If you're a heavy user who spends a lot of time on your phone, opt for a model with a larger battery capacity. For lighter users, a smaller battery may be sufficient.
PerformancePerformance is influenced by the smartphone's processor and RAM. LG smartphones come with various processors and RAM sizes, affecting how smoothly the phone runs apps and multitasks. High-end processors and more RAM are ideal for gaming and intensive applications, while mid-range options are suitable for everyday tasks like browsing and social media. Consider your usage needs to determine the right balance of performance for you.
StorageStorage capacity determines how much data you can keep on your smartphone, including apps, photos, and videos. LG smartphones offer different storage options, typically ranging from 32GB to 256GB or more. If you store a lot of media or install many apps, opt for higher storage capacity. For basic usage, lower storage options may be adequate. Some models also support expandable storage via microSD cards, providing additional flexibility.
Operating SystemThe operating system (OS) is the software that runs the smartphone. LG smartphones typically use Android OS, which offers a wide range of apps and customization options. The version of the OS can affect performance and features, with newer versions generally providing better security and functionality. Ensure the smartphone runs a recent version of Android to take advantage of the latest features and updates.
Build QualityBuild quality refers to the materials and construction of the smartphone. LG smartphones come in various build qualities, from plastic to metal and glass. Higher-end materials like metal and glass often feel more premium and durable but can be more prone to damage if dropped. Consider how you use your phone and whether you need a more rugged build or prefer a sleek, premium feel.
